CitizensNYC, founded in 1975, is one of New York City's pioneering microgranting organizations, dedicated to empowering local leaders and grassroots initiatives across the five boroughs. With a commitment to building connected and resilient communities, CitizensNYC provides financial and capacity-building support, distributing over $1 million in microgrants annually for projects that enhance neighborhood life and foster community partnerships.
The organization offers Community Leaders Grants and Neighborhood Business Grants, each providing up to $5,000 to support a diverse array of projects in areas such as arts and culture, education, health and wellness, and economic development. By facilitating a network for community leaders, CitizensNYC strengthens the social and economic fabric of New York City through collaboration and shared resources.
